I just received a phone call from Brian in response to my email and he said it was OK if I post our conversation here. In summary, he said the contract with The Advocate calls for use of Louisiana or Louisiana Ragin Cajuns and that is being implemented in the coming days. He said 5 years ago this wasn't the case, but today, the owners of The Advocate understand the importance and relevance of UL and Lafayette (Acadiana) and are on board with promoting the second largest university in the state. (Not to mention when we achieve Doc I status in the near future.) We are going to see headers in BR, Acadiana and in NO that say Louisiana or Louisiana Ragin Cajuns and the articles will be using Louisiana as our reference as well as UL. No more UL-Lafayette. This was all agreed to and should have been implemented from day one. But, the guy in charge of implementation at The Advocate resisted as an LSU guy, and management is getting this corrected. And, Learfield is pushing our Louisiana branding initiative within its client base that includes many prominent universities around the country as well as several state-wide schools in Louisiana and, of course, the national media.
